Morning fellow GF fans...

We are recently back from another wonderful GF stay...:lovestruc...and I wanted to share some observations from our trip....

~Check in...This has been a subject much in question around here since the change in procedure...well...it definitely has not been ironed out yet...:scared:..lobby was busy..no greeters inside.. as.. from what I understand there generally are ?? So we inquired if there was a designated line for CL check in...nope..just stand on any of these lines..:sad2:...so we waited..a while...not a catastrophe..but not so great either...

~Hotel/lobby/common areas and grounds...The hotel itself grounds included was looking Grand!! The lobby areas looked fresh,clean and tidy... the new carpet is a nice hue of dusty green and very Victorian looking...lots of fresh plantings...and many things in bloom added to the feeling of spring having arrived...

~Rooms..Here again..clean and fresh ...one change that we saw was..no turn down cards along with the chocolates..fortunately...they are still using those yummy creamy Belgian chocolates..but..I always thought the cards were such a nice touch...now in the last year or so..we have seen them come and go..so..maybe they are not gone for good...who knows...

~CL food offerings..oh I know this is a biggie...lol..its always about the food...;)..breakfast offerings were the SAME as usual..including meats ( fresh turkey and a deli ham)..and cheeses too...I did inquire..and was told that these are back on the breakfast "menu"...there was a nice variety of buns/muffins...cut fruits were cantelope, honeydew, pineapple and watermelon...the usual toasting station..bagels, a few different breads..and one spread besides the traditional butter and cream cheese..no additional spreads..these were discontinued a while back ..unfortunately .. two cold cereals and yogurt too...

Afternoon offerings seem to be the same also..veggies..chips and dips...dome bread sticks and breads..but honestly..we were not really around much in the afternoon...ONE thing that was missing at tea time was the wonderful triffle...but they did add a very delicious red velvet cupcake with a sweet cream cheese icing..yum...

Evening appetizers also seemed to be pretty much the same..two hot appetizers and two or three cold appetizers..and a cold soup...cheese and nut platter..still mixed together...childrens offerings were uncrustables..either corn dogs or chicken nuggets...not both on the same nights...I took some pics which I will post..just trying to organize them first... :confused:...lol..

Desserts...They were ok..pretty much the same as we have seen in the last year or so...about four or 5 different items..fruit tarts, a choclate cake, key lime and chocolate tarts...and banana bread I'm guessing left from tea time..??? The children's area had brownies, cookies..and vanilla frosted cupcakes with a bowl of mickey sprinkles next to them so that the cupcakes could be decorated...this seemed to be popular...and..messy!! :rotfl:

Beverages..Sodas...coke, diet coke, sprite,gingerale and also small bottles of water..the water was always added in the evenings...as for adult beverages..again I will post pics...wines..less brands than before ..some changes I know people are not happy about, champagne..and yes cordials! There was DiSoronno and a few others...updating...Kahlua and Amarula are the other two...Have to look at the pics to be sure..lol..I looked quickly..and snapped a photo...hmmm..maybe another trip is in order..just to jog my memory...:rolleyes1...Disney logic at work...lol..

Lounge Area ~The lounge itself was busy...especially in the mornings...but food was always replenished as far as we saw...and although we always bus our own tables...I noticed many others did not..but the staff really stayed on top of that..one morning in particular was very busy and I even observed a manager cleaning tables...::yes::..

~Monorail..No long waits..and they seemed to be running very regularly..

~Bus service..Also..Running regularly..we even took the bus one afternoon to Disney Springs without much of a wait...:thumbsup2... there was also a CM at the bus stop advising folks about the bus schedule..

~Shops..And I will say we did visit them all...lol...which are all generally and continue to be pretty well stocked.. did have some new resort specific merchandise..which was nice to see..

~CMs...As always..were friendly..and helpful...

The resort does seem to be in some transition...some things that we will miss, some not so important...and some new things to enjoy( retro beach party..on certain dates, the Princess Promenade..if you are at the resort one afternoon at about 3:30 I would recommend taking the time to see this...Disney magic at its finest! and the resort tour )...we did not get the time to do the new tour..but are looking forward to doing it another time...

All in all..we enjoyed every bit of our resort time...and while the check in process definitely needs some fine tuning...we really did have a Grand stay! :wizard:
